用手机写编码,绝对不用电脑编码。
电脑可以用的为什么手机不能用?即使运行不了,你也不要在电脑上写代码,这样你的代码才能变成垃圾代码。
学习时不要预习
提前预习所要学的知识只是浪费时间而已,你应当利用更多的时间敲垃圾代码。
什么都学一点
省下预习的时间,你也可以在各个领域涉猎,在基础未打扎实之前,多学习不同的知识。
看到题目就直接写代码
编写高质量代码是这样一个流程:先想好思路、规划可行性、编写代码、验证、修改。但你不需要足够的规划和研究。
命名不明确,越混淆越好。
如 Let age = 42 let a = 42
我们键入的东西越少,那么就有太多的时间去思考代码逻辑等问题。
变量/函数不写全,简写或混合。
如 let windowwidth=640 let wwidth =640
简写代码才能节省时间写更多的代码,管他电脑能不能识别,你的代码你做主。
不要写注释
自己的代码自己清楚就可以了,不用写注释给别人看。
以下这个注释行为,会严重影响你写垃圾代码的进度。
有多少格式混合多少格式
最好和上面那些建议结合,这样你的代码一定是最垃圾的,电脑都不会认同。
尽可能把代码写成一行
不要空行或分行,这样才能节省空间写更多的代码。
不要处理错误
无论何时发现错误,都没有必要让任何人知道它。不设置提醒,没有错误弹框。
创建你不会使用的变量
如下:
如果语言允许,不要指定类型和/或不执行类型检查。
如下:
做你不能到达的代码
将代码奇怪的排列
不要遵循代码规则,排出你喜欢的形状。
混合缩进
避免缩进,因为它们会使复杂的代码在编辑器中占用更多的空间。如果你不喜欢回避他们,那就和他们捣乱。
函数长的比短的好
不要把程序逻辑分成可读的部分。如果IDE的搜索停止,而你无法找到所需的文件或函数时,应该:
一个文件中10000行代码是OK的。
一个函数体1000行代码是OK的。
处理许多服务(第三方和内部,也有一些工具、数据库手写ORM和jQuery滑块)在一个' service.js ' ?这是OK的。
不要测试你的代码
你写的代码一定是最棒的,没有错误,不需要浪费时间做重复的工作。
避免代码风格统一
编写您想要的代码,特别是在一个团队中有多个开发人员的情况下。这是一个“自由”的原则。
构建新项目不需要 README 文档
一开始我们就应该保持。
保存不必要的代码
不要删除不用的代码,保留它,以作备用。
好的,按上面建议的方法写代码,无论你是新手还是老手,你的代码一定会在变废的路上一去不复返。你的同事或同学一定会认可你的代码是垃圾。你一定会被授予“”垃圾代码之王”的称号,这个称号是你这么努力写垃圾代码的认可。
学习的过程注定是辛苦的,只有一步一个脚印,从基础要求自己,才能越来越好。如果你希望写出好的代码,请一定要避免上述的这些行为,从小细节做起。这样走下去,会有更大的成就在等着你~
领取专属 10元无门槛券
私享最新 技术干货